Abstract
The utility model relates to the technical field of projection screens, particularly to a simple support screen structure. The structure comprises a supporting seat and a screen, wherein the screen isconnected onto the supporting seat via a foldable support component. The foldable support component comprises a block-shaped supporting rod connecting part, grooves, a hole, two supporting rods and fasteners, wherein the grooves are symmetrically arranged on two sides of the supporting rod connecting part; the hole connected with an upright column is disposed at the bottom of the block-shaped supporting rod connecting part; the two supporting rods respectively embedded inside the grooves of the block-shaped supporting rod connecting part rotate correspondingly to the supporting rod connectingpart via a pivoting element inside the grooves and horizontally support the screen; the fasteners for being fastened with fastener holes of the screen supporting rods are arranged at the end portionsof the other ends of the two supporting rods. The screen comprises a square screen body, screen supporting rods, fastener holes and ornamental covers, wherein the screen supporting rods are arrangedon two lateral edges of the screen, the fastener holes for being fastened with the fasteners of foldable support component supporting rods are arranged in the middle of the screen supporting rods, andthe ornamental covers are disposed at two ends of each fastener hole. The simple support screen structure has the advantages of simple structure, convenient and labor-saving operation, easy lifting of the screen, convenient movement and carrying and safe use.
Description
Technical field
The utility model relates to the projection screen technical field, relates in particular to a kind of simple rack curtain structure.
Background technology
Existing stent-type lifting projection screen is made up of projection screen, following pipe, fall way, tripod etc., but its complex structure, inconvenient operation, and cause the damage of projection screen and operating personnel injured easily, and have influence on the use of projection screen, bring inconvenience to the user.

Embodiment
The utility model is described in further detail below in conjunction with accompanying drawing.
Embodiment one, as Fig. 1, Fig. 2, Fig. 3, shown in Figure 4, this simple rack curtain structure that the utility model provides comprises supporting seat 102, curtain 101, curtain 101 is connected on the supporting seat 102 through Collapsible rack assembly 103.
In the present embodiment, supporting seat 102 is scalable A-frame, Collapsible rack assembly 103 comprises a block pole support connector 1031 and two poles 1032, pole support connector 1031 is oval block, its symmetria bilateralis is provided with groove, the bottom is provided with the hole that is connected with column, but two poles, 1,032 one ends are nested in respectively in the groove and make two poles 1032 rotate also cross-brace curtain 101 relative to block pole support connector 1031 vertical direction between groove area by pivot connecting element; Two poles, 1032 other end ends are provided with buckle, curtain 101 comprises square curtain body and is arranged on the curtain pole 1011 of curtain 101 dual-sides, be provided with hole clipping in the middle of the curtain pole 1011, its two ends are provided with trim 1012, two poles 1032 and curtain 101 by fixedlying connected described buckle and cooperating of hole clipping.
In the present embodiment, described block pole support connector 1031 grooves are set to the transverse horizontal axis of both sides above this bulk pole support connector 1031 and the fluting in vertical axis interval, make two poles 1032 rotate in 0 of the transverse horizontal axis of both sides and vertical axis interval degree~90 degree scopes above block pole support connector 1031 respectively.
In a further embodiment, block pole support connector 1031 top middle portion are provided with perpendicular positioning bar 1033, this backstay 1033 is fixedlyed connected with curtain 101 tops by the connecting elements 1034 of end disposed thereon, in the present embodiment, connecting elements 1034 is fixedlyed connected with curtain 101 tops by VELCRO; Be connected with the draw-in groove buckle that is arranged on connecting elements 1034 both sides when two poles 1032 rotate to vertical direction, can reinforce the installation stability of curtain 101 like this, make curtain 101 smooth expansion.
Can be preferred, column comprises big column 104 and post 105, fixedly connected with supporting seat 102 in big column 104 lower ends, post 105 upper ends are nested in the hole of pole support connector 1031 bottoms, its lower end is nested in the big column 104, and the expansion link mechanism 106 by being installed in big column 104 upper ends is can big relatively column 104 vertical directions flexible, expansion link mechanism 106 is made up of with the flexible pole socket pressure handle 1061 that is arranged on flexible pole socket 1062 appearances and pole socket 1062 vertical direction of can should stretching are relatively rotated to the flexible pole socket 1062 of through hole tape spool, big column 104 upper ends are nested in the through hole of expansion link mechanism 106 from the below, post 105 lower ends are nested in the through hole of expansion link mechanism 106 from the top, when flexible pole socket pressure handle 1061 rotates to horizontal level, thereby the height lifting curtain 101 of scalable post 105, when flexible pole socket pressure handle 1061 rotates to vertical position, one end fits tightly with the shell fragment that is arranged on the flexible pole socket 1062, and shell fragment locks post 105 inwards and reaches the vertical columns purpose.
In a further embodiment, two poles, 1032 middle parts are provided with the transfer buckle of being convenient to install, and this transfer buckle can be connected with hole clipping buckle on the curtain pole 1011.
Because curtain 101 broads, when people's operation is installed and used, as shown in Figure 1, the supporting seat 102 that Collapsible rack assembly 103 and column are installed is placed on the ground, with two poles, 1032 horizontal openings in the Collapsible rack assembly 103, open curtain 101, hold curtain both sides curtain pole 1011 respectively with two hands, earlier a wing flats cloth pole 1011 is hung on the buckle of a Collapsible rack assembly pole 1032 centres, then opposite side curtain pole 1011 is hung on the end anchors of another pole 1032 of Collapsible rack assembly 103, can vacate hand like this hangs over a former wing flats cloth pole 1011 on the buckle of Collapsible rack assembly 103 1 poles 1032 ends, at last, by VELCRO curtain 101 top middle portion are fixedlyed connected with the connecting elements 1034 of location supporting rod 1033 upper ends, to reinforce the stability of curtain 101, make curtain 101 be able to complete smooth expansion.Such people just easily operates the installation of finishing projection screen 101.Simultaneously, the high and low position by rotary extension pole socket pressure handle 1061 drop scenes 101.
When finishing using, now the connecting elements 1034 of curtain 101 tops with location supporting rod 1033 upper ends separated, then a wing flats cloth pole 1011 is taken off from the pole 1032 of Collapsible rack assembly 103, it is hung on the buckle of these pole 1032 centres, afterwards, opposite side curtain pole 1011 is taken off from another pole 1032 of Collapsible rack assembly 103, then take off last wing flats cloth pole 1011 again, like this, curtain 101 just takes off from Collapsible rack assembly 103 very easily, it is packed up to opposite side from side volume again.Then, two poles 1032 of Collapsible rack assembly 103 are upwards packed up from horizontal level, be stuck in the grooves on two sides of location supporting rod 1033 upper end connecting elements 1034, the pole socket pressure handle 1061 that will stretch rotates to horizontal level, make post 105 foreshorten to extreme lower position downwards, at this moment, can take off Collapsible rack assembly 103, with Collapsible rack assembly 103, curtain 101 and be connected with the neat together folding and unfolding of the supporting seat 102 of column in sack, be convenient for carrying.
